The graphic adventures of a mouse.
…in which our dauntless rodent hero, drawn in 30s comic strip style, takes on life, love, loss and death in stoic cartoon fashion. This is a beautiful collection of early work from the award-winning author of Jimmy Corrigan: The Smartest Kid On Earth. Ware’s sometimes exhausting experimentation with form means that each page is like a maze to be navigated by the reader in search of meaning. However, s/he is amply rewarded for the effort, as the author’s achingly melancholic humour colours each of the hapless mouse’s adventures.
